> This patch (or a later version of it) made it into mainline and causes a
> large number of qemu boot test failures for various architectures (arm,
> m68k, microblaze, sparc32, xtensa are the ones I observed). Common
> denominator is that boot hangs at "Saving random seed:". A sample bisect
> log is attached. Reverting this patch fixes the problem.

Ok, it was worth trying, but yeah, it clearly causes problems for
various platforms that can't do jitter entropy and have nothing else
happening either.

Will revert.
